Spinoff Novels
Pocket Books - 1990s to 2000s
New Frontier: Book 1 - House of CardsPocket Books - PB: 07/97Peter David When the Thallonian Empire collapses, throwing an entire star system into chaos, Starfleet sends the USS Excalibur, a newly-refitted Ambassador-class starship to help where it can and report what it finds.
New Frontier: Book 2 - Into the VoidPocket Books - PB: 07/97Peter David The USS Excalibur, with Captain Mackenzie Calhoun in command and Commander Shelby as First Officer, sets out toward the Thallonian Empire; but Calhoun soon finds himself contending with an unexpected stowaway and a stormy relationship with his crew.
New Frontier: Book 3 - The Two-Front WarPocket Books - PB: 08/97Peter David As the USS Excalibur attempts to rescue the Thallonian refugees aboard a stranded vessel, the starship is attacked by an unknown intruder; meanwhile, the Excalibut's Vulcan Dr. Selar learns of a shocking secret from her past.
New Frontier: Book 4 - End GamePocket Books - PB: 08/97Peter David As the Thallonian homeworld faces destruction, Captain Calhoun must face his own bloody past in a life-and-death struggle for survival and honor; meanwhile, Commander Shelby faces a difficult decision of her own.
New Frontier: Book 5 - MartyrPocket Books - PB: 03/98Peter David When civil war threatens the planet Zondar, Captain Calhoun of the USS Excalibur finds himself being greeted by the planet's populace as a great savior; but he's soon captured by a rebel group that sees him as a blashpemer.
New Frontier: Book 6 - Fire on HighPocket Books - PB: 04/98Peter David A lieutenant on the USS Excalibur, a woman held prisoner on the Thallonian homeworld, and a mysterious woman on the planet Armista who has control of a weapon that can kill an entire planet's population hold the key to the survival of billions.
New Frontier: Book 7 - The Quiet PlacePocket Books - PB: 11/99Peter David A search for his long-missing sister leads a member of the Excalibur crew to a planet where a mysterious woman is pursued by the fanatical Redeemers and a vicious race of predators called the Dogs of War, all of whom are searching for a mystical place called the Quiet Place.
New Frontier: Book 8 - Dark AlliesPocket Books - PB: 11/99Peter David Captain Calhoun and the Excalibur find themselves having to work with their deadly enemies, the Redeemers, in order to save innocent lives from an alien life-form known as the Black Mass that consumed an entire solar system in the Thallonian Empire many years ago.
New Frontier: Book 9 - RequiemPocket Books - PB: 09/2000Peter David The USS Excalibur has been destroyed and Captain Calhoun has been lost and, as the rest of the crew await their new assignments, several members are sent on an undercover mission to investigate a series of alien abductions on a low-tech world.
New Frontier: Book 10 - RenaissancePocket Books - PB: 09/2000Peter David As the Excalibur's crew go to their new assignments, Dr. Selar finds herself in an interstellar battle for custody of her recently-born child.
New Frontier: Book 11 - RestorationPocket Books - HC: 11/2000 - PB: 11/2001Peter David With the USS Excalibur destroyed and her captain thought dead, First Officer Shelby is given command of the USS Exeter; but Captain Calhoun is alive and held hostage on a hostile world.
New Frontier: Book 12 - Being HumanPocket Books - PB: 11/2001Peter David Mark McHenry, navigator of the USS Excalibur, had demonstrated abilities beyond those of humans and now, as a solar system is menaced by a destructive power, the source of McHenry's unusual abilities is revealed.
New Frontier: Gods AbovePocket Books - PB: 10/2003Peter David Much like Captain Kirk before him, Captain Calhoun and the USS Excalibur face off against powerful alien beings who claim to have been the gods of Greek, Roman, and Norse mythology.
New Frontier: Stone and AnvilPocket Books - HC: 10/2003 - 10/2004Peter David Captain Calhoun of the USS Excalibur must question his trust in a non-human member of his crew, who is accused of a murder aboard another starship, a murder which threatens to escalate into a diplomatic crisis.
New Frontier: No LimitsPocket Books - PB: 10/2003Edited by Peter David A collection of 18 short stories about the USS Excalibur and its crew.
New Frontier: After the FallPocket Books - HC: 11/2004 - PB: 12/2005Peter David Three years have passed and the crew members of the USS Excalibur have moved one; but now a new peril faces the galaxy, as the sister of the Thallonian Proctorate's prime minister is abducted by a long-forgotten enemy.
New Frontier: Missing in ActionPocket Books - HC: 02/2006 - PB: 01/2007Peter David Captain Calhoun and the crew of the USS Excalibur find themselves propelled into a universe where an ancient war rages on between two powerful alien races.

Starfleet: Year OnePocket Books - PB: 03/2002Michael Jan Friedman A trio of candidates jockey for the honor of being named captain of the new United Federation of Planet's Starfleet flagship, the USS Deadalus; but they must work together to fight an unknown alien race destroying bases in a nearby star system. [NOTE: This novel does not coincide with the history of Starfleet presented in the Star Trek series "Enterprise."]
Stargazer: Book 1 - GauntletPocket Books - PB: 05/2002Michael Jan Friedman The pirate known as the White Wolf has been wreaking havoc across several sectors, and the young Captain Picard and the USS Stargazer have been assigned to stop him.
Stargazer: Book 2 - ProgenitorPocket Books - PB: 05/2002Michael Jan Friedman While Picard and his senior staff accompany their chief engineer to his homeworld for a ritual ceremony, the Stargazer is left under the command of her first officer, when a distress call comes in from a nearby star system and takes the ship on a dangerous mission.
Stargazer: ThreePocket Books - PB: 08/2003Michael Jan Friedman The bond between twin sisters aboard the USS Stargazer is tested when a mysterious woman from another universe, who looks just like them, appears at the same time that treachery begins aboard the starship.
Stargazer: OblivionPocket Books - PB: 09/2003Michael Jan Friedman Before he brought her onto the Enterprise-D, Captain Picard had an encounter with the mysterious Guinan, an encounter aboard the USS Stargazer with a much different person than the one Picard knew aboard the Enterprise.
Stargazer: EnigmaPocket Books - PB: 08/2004Michael Jan Friedman When a myserious alien race begins to attack Starfleet vessels, the USS Stargazer, commanded by a young Captain Picard, is order to help form a line of defense against the attacker.
Stargazer: MakerPocket Books - PB: 09/2004Michael Jan Friedman When a member of USS Stargazer's crew resigns and is later kidnapped by a powerful alien intent on starting a war between the Federation and one its most xenophobic adversaries, Captain Picard must enlist the aid of a woman who had previously abused his trust in order to end the crisis.
IKS Gorkon: Book 1 - A Good Day to DiePocket Books - PB: 11/2003Keith R.A. DeCandido Captain Klag of the IKS Gorkon leads his crew to an unexplored sector, where they find a planet with a species that has a civilization similar to that of the Klingons and which challenges the Klingons to a series of martial arts contests with the winner gaining control of the planet.
IKS Gorkon: Book 2 - Honor BoundPocket Books - PB: 12/2003Keith R.A. DeCandido Captain Klag is the newest inductee in Chancellor Martok's newly-reformed Order of the Bat'leth, and he now is confronted by another Klingon captain intent on conquering a planet to which Klag had sworn peaceful co-existence with the Klingons.
IKS Gorkon: Book 3 - Enemy TerritoryPocket Books - PB: 03/2005Keith R.A. DeCandido The IKS Gorkon goes to investigate the destruction of another Klingon ship that ventured into a star system controlled by the Elabrej, a race that firmly believed itself to be alone in the universe.
Titan: Book 1 - Taking WingPocket Books - PB: 04/2005Michael A. Martin - Andy Mangels After the fall of Praetor Shinzon, a power struggle begins to develop in the Romulan Empire, and Captain Riker and the USS Titan are sent to try to broker a peaceful solution to the situation; but the remnants of the Tal Shiar are working behind the scenes to gain power for themselves.
Titan: Book 2 - The Red KingPocket Books - PB: 10/2005Michael A. Martin - Andy Mangels The USS Titan, under command of Captain Riker, is propelled more than 200,000 light years into the Small Magellanic Cloud, where they encounter the Neyel, a long-forgotten offshoot of humanity, which brings to mind ghosts from Riker's past.
Titan: Book 3 - Orion's HoundsPocket Books - PB: 01/2006Christopher L. Bennett Aboard the USS Titan, Deanna Troi is overwhelmed by an alien cry of distress from a giant spaceborne species being hunted by interstellar "whalers," and the Titan's crew must try to find a way to negotiate an end to the carnage, only to find that things are not what they seem.
Titan: Book 4 - Sword of DamoclesPocket Books - PB: 10/2007Geoffrey Thorne The USS Titan travels to Orisha, a world whose civilization has developed under the threat of destruction presented by an unbelievable celestial body in the planet's sky; now Captain Riker and his crew must try to understand this mysterious body.

Articles of the FederationPocket Books - PB: 06/2005Keith R.A. DeCandido After the resignation of the prior Federation President and the choas in the Romulan Empire as a result of the death of Shinzon, a Reman ship approaches a Federation outpost, but the first contact turns into a disaster, which plunges the new Federation government into turmoil.
Vanguard: Book 1 - HarbingerPocket Books - PB: 08/2005David Mack Captain Kirk is suspicious when Starfleet established Starbase 47, also known as Vanguard, very near Tholian space, and when a disaster occurs in an area of space called the Taurus Reach, the Enterprise rushes to help Vanguard's crew in their response to the disaster.
Vanguard: Book 2 - Summon the ThunderPocket Books - PB: 07/2006Dayton Ward - Kevin Dilmore As the crew of Vanguard and two starships sent to assist try to find and understand the secrets of the Taurus Reach, an ancient mind awakens from eons of hibernation and lashes out against the new intruders.
Vanguard: Book 3 - Reap the WhirlwindPocket Books - PB: 06/2007David Mack The Federation, Klingon Empire, and Tholian Assembly are wrestling for control of a planet in the Taurus Reach; but the race that ruled this area of space eons ago have awaken and is marshalling its forces to retake their territory.

Excelsior: Book 1 - Forged in FirePocket Books - PB: 01/2008Michael A. Martin - Andy Mangels A vicious pirate with a secret that can bring down the Klingon Empire is cutting a deadly swath across space; now Captain Hikaru Sulu and the crew of the USS Excelsior, with help from Klingon captains Kor, Koloth, and Kang, plus the young Curzon Dax begin their hunt for this pirate.
Klingon Empire: Book 1 - A Burning HousePocket Books - PB: 02/2008Keith R.A. DeCandido The IKS Gorkon returns to the Klingon homeworld of Qo'noS to find the empire in disarray because of intrigue and betrayal brewing between the strongest houses of the empire.
Destiny: Book 1 - Gods of NightPocket Books - PB: 10/2008David Mack More than a year after the fall of Shinzon, the Borg are on the offensive again, with nothing less than total annihilation of the Federation as their goal. Elsewhere, one of Earth's first-generation starships is found on a desolate planet in the Gamma Quadrant.
Destiny: Book 2 - Mere MortalsPocket Books - PB: 11/2008David Mack While Captains Picard and Ezri Dax join forces to try to stop the Borg advance, half a galaxy away, Captain Riker deals with a race of god-like beings who have changed the fabric of time and space in their sphere of influence, which has trapped a starship and her crew in an infinite time loop.
Destiny: Book 3 - Lost SoulsPocket Books - PB: 12/2008David Mack As the Borg continue their march across the galaxy, Captains Picard, Riker, and Dax must set aside personal biases and priorities to save the Federation from annihilation and assimilation.
A Singular DestinyPocket Books - PB: 02/2009Keith R.A. DeCandido Known space has been devastated by the Borg march across the galaxy, and as the remaining powers try to deal with the aftermath, a new danger begins to further destablize the Federation and both the Klingon and Romulan empires.
